54% of Belgian network is equipped with ETCS

Brussels-Midi – Halle railInfrabel reached the ETCS milestone following the installation of the digital system on 127 km of Brussels-Midi – Halle rail line which now brings the ETCS – equipped rail network to 54%.

The major signalling work on the section included various station locations such as Bruxelles-Midi, Halle, Boondael, Holleken, Petite Île, Anderlecht, Forest and around 15 teams from the rail infrastructure manager carried out the final adjustments and tests for the installation and commissioning of 650 ETCS beaconsalong the tracks.These beacons ensure the transmission of information from the ground to the trains.In total, 300 signals were equipped with ETCS and 3,200 potential routes have been tested.

Out of the 127 km of main tracks were equipped with ETCS, 66 km  are in the rail grids of Brussels-Midi station, 18 km between Brussels-Midi and Lembeek, and 43 km between Forest and Holleken and between Hal and Boondael.

About 1,200 passenger trains pass through Brussels-Midi station every day, which is a third of all the trains that run daily on the Belgian rail network. The installation of the digital signalling system on this line is a continuation of the previous phase which took place on 18 December 2022 when Infrabel completed to equip 58 km of main tracks (equipping 320 signals) between the Brussels-Midi station and Schaerbeek station, the so-called North-Midi junction, with works carried out on the other side of Brussels-Midi station.

With the commissioning of ETCS in the area between Brussels-Midi and Halle, the heart of our rail network is now fully equipped with ETCS. The installation of the European safety system is and will remain a top priority for Infrabel Together with the automated rail traffic management systems, ETCS offers our customers the highest level of safety and strengthens Belgium’s position as having one of the best equipped and therefore the safest in Europe,” Benoît Gilson, CEO Infrabel said.

Following the ETCS deployment on the Brussels-Midi – Halle rail line, Infrabel managed to equip 54% of its rail network, representing 3,462 km. The aim is to install ETCS on the entire Belgian railway rail infrastructure by the end of 2025.

The Belgian rail network is equipped with the ETCS L1 (limited and full supervision solutions) with full supervision deployed on the Corridor C, the freight axis from the port of Antwerp via Leuven and Namur to Athus, and on lines 10 and 36C/2 and the Ans – Angleur section and line 36/37 equipped with ETCS level 2. The lines where the ETCS1+2 FS with full supervision is installed, it allows the train driver to receive signal and speed information it its cab. This system is installed on high-speed lines to Germany and to the Netherlands.

The network is also equipped with TVM-430 (transmission voies-machine), a French system implemented only on high-speed line 1 between Lembeek and the French border. The operation is similar to ETCS as the driver’s cab picks up a signal transmitted by the tracks, informing the driver of his speed in relation to the authorised speed limit.
